Our staffs in School of Pharmacy, WU published their research in Q1 Phytochemical Analysis Journal

Let’s congratulate our staff, Assist. Prof. Dr. Gorawit Yosakul and Ajarn Suppalak Paisan to have their research entitled “Immunochromatographic assay for the detection of kwakhurin and its application for the identification of Pueraria candollei var. marifica (Airy Shaw & Suvat.) Niyomdham” published in the Q1 journal Phytomedical Analysis.

Their research has developed a simple-use strip test based on the immunochromatographic assay to specifically detect a kwakhurin compound, which exists only in Pueraria mirifica. This has rendered the high capability of differentiation between the two most common Pueraria spp. Plants, which have completely distinct pharmacological effects.

The strip test developed in their research has highlighted the importance of plant identification prior to proceeding to drug development processes and can be used to ensure the quantity control of Thai herbal products.
